Conventional flat roof assembly. The colder the climate the thicker the rigid insulation required. Of course flat roofs are not flat but have a very slight roof pitch of between 1 4 to 1 2 per foot. Just enough slope to drain water but also flat enough to be a problem if not constructed properly.
The components of a conventional flat roof assembly varies very little from roof to roof. Unvented flat roof assembly.
